# ORM Refactor: Who to Ping

The old Brambleworks ORM layer is being replaced module by module under project Uproot. If you hit a page caused by a half-migrated model — weird double-writes, phantom transactions — don't patch it yourself at 3 a.m. Roll back the feature flag and message the Uproot crew.

escalation mailbox, bafog-fafog: ulador@paliqlabs.internal

Bulk edits in the Varnholt admin table intermittently fail CI on the Pellax runner pool. Root cause: the seed fixture loads 10k rows but the batch-update test assumes 5k, so pagination assertions flake. Fix merged; fixtures now parameterized. Retries dropped from 14% to under 1%. Reference the affected build with the token below.

pipeline stamp: htk31_f769b577b3028a4e9958e5bb8d1259a

## Sweeper Limits & Quotas

The Tidemark sweeper walks every project in Glintworks Cloud and deletes resources whose parent was removed more than a grace window ago. It's deliberately throttled — we once melted the metadata store by letting it free-run, and nobody wants a repeat. Quotas are per-region, and the sweeper backs off hard when the API returns pressure signals. If you bump anything, bump slowly. The current tuning constants are listed below.

constants for bagaf-hadup:
QUOTAS = {
    "quenael": 1,
    "ralwyn": 1,
    "oliath": 2,
    "ulaael": 2,
}